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Flower-faced Bat | Leopard shark |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(Chordates)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Mammalia (Mammals) | Chondrichthyes (Cartilaginous Fish) |
| Order | Chiroptera (Bats) | Carcharhiniformes (Ground Sharks) |
| Family | Hipposideridae | Triakidae |
| Genus | Anthops | Triakis |
| Species | Anthops ornatus | Triakis semifasciata |
Evolutionary Relationship
Flower-faced Bat and Leopard shark share a common ancestor at the Phylum level: Chordata. (Chordates)
